1-10.
That’s Zac Taylor’s current record over the past six years in the first two games of the regular season; I fear Kansas City will make it 1-11 next week. Not many 0-2 teams make it to the playoffs.
I’m afraid Zac’s legacy will be one of unpreparedness. He needs the starters to play more in the preseason from now on. The ONE time the Bengals won their opening game of the season under Zac they went to the Super Bowl.
